The sign-up procedure for is really quite long: it took me about 20 to thirty minutes to finish, so ensure you reserve time to complete it because if you stop mid-sign-up and leave your internet browser, it will not save your answers and you’ll have to begin all over again.

From there, you’ll be asked a series of concerns in a consumption questionnaire about your gender identity, age, sexual orientation, and relationship status. It is worth keeping in mind that the business offers a range of options for explaining your gender identity and sexual preference. For instance, you can select from female, man, non-binary, transfeminine, transmasculine, agender, “I don’t know”, “Prefer not to state”, and “Other” for explaining your gender identity. Relatively, gives users more options to describe their gender than Talkspace does. In detailing your sexual preference, you are given the choices of straight, gay, lesbian, bi/pan, “Prefer not to say”, “Questioning”, queer, nonsexual, “I do not know”, and “Other”.

After the concerns about your identity and religious affiliation, you will be asked to finish questions about your psychological health history, such as whether you have actually ever remained in treatment before and what led you to treatment today. Options for what led you to therapy include “I have actually been feeling depressed”, “My state of mind is hindering my job/school efficiency”, “I am grieving”, and 10 other options. Then, you will be asked what your expectations are from your therapist, such as a therapist who listens, explores your past, teaches your brand-new skills, appoints you research, and more.

The platform will ask you to rate your current physical health and eating routines from good, reasonable, and bad.

Then, it will ask you if you are experiencing overwhelming sadness or depression. Following this, there will be a few concerns from the Client Health Questionnaire, or the PHQ-9, an assessment used to evaluate for anxiety.

If you are currently used as well as how frequently you consume alcohol, you will be asked. Other screening concerns towards the end include if you have any problems with intimacy and when the last time you thought of suicide was– if ever.
